Permit’s Confront it, when you are diving in to the deep ocean of the net, you are certain to bump into the expression Alexa Internet site Rating. But Exactly what does it basically suggest? Plus more importantly, why in the event you treatment? If you have ever wondered how https://collinndltg.blog-gold.com/48086269/an-unbiased-view-of-website-page-traffic-checker
Fascination About Alexa Internet Ranking
Internet 8 hours ago earlev863mrv6Web Directory Categories
Web Directory Search
New Site Listings